2. Freshness
If you purchase coffee from a shop the beans are ground a while back. When they are in your mug, their unique flavour will disappear. Bean-to cup machines allow you to grind whole beans at home and brew it fresh.
If you love cappuccinos and lattes, then the best bean-to cup machines for milk-based drinks will feature an integrated steamer and a frother. It is easier to make creamy, layered milk-based coffees by pressing a button.
They usually come with various settings that allow you to alter the strength of your coffee as well as control the temperature. Some of the more expensive models allow you to alter the size of the grind in order to extract maximum flavor.

3. Cleanliness is convenient
Bean to cup machines unlike traditional coffee machines, grind the beans before the drink is prepared, giving it a fresh, delicious taste. This makes them a great option for anyone looking to enjoy a delicious cup of coffee without the hassle of buying pre-ground coffee that is stale or waiting for the office kettle to boil.
All you have to do is choose your preferred drink from the menu and the machine will take care of everything else. It will grind the beans to the appropriate size for each drink, then brew and steam the milk to perfection, and then serve it right away. It's easy to do and it's extremely fast as well, saving you time and money.
Many bean to cup machines also come with a descaling programme that helps to keep the machine clean. This is important, especially when you live in an area with hard water. Limescale may build up within the machine, which can reduce the flow of water. Regular cleaning can extend the life of your machine and avoid expensive call-out fees.
